"You damn bastard!" The Deviator's provocation had found its perfect target.
Levi's suppressed rage ignited once more.
For over a decade, he had lived underground, evading the Deviator's pursuit.
In the past, he had witnessed intimate companions being confined to livestock cages, only to meet their demise.
Hearing those words again, he couldn't contain the flames in his heart.
"I'll tear you to pieces!" Levi shouted.
The essence he had been conserving for a long-term battle was ignited in that moment.
His angry voice reverberated through the air, causing the air currents to oscillate and overlap, resulting in even more violent and chaotic forces that rushed towards his opponent.
Boom!
In the confined space, the storm raged.
The airflow within the entire cavern became extremely turbulent.
This Deviator, with a seemingly Fifth Phase strength, could only retreat under Levi's relentless assault, and was pinned against the edge of the cavern wall.
Stab!
Just then, the Deviator felt an odd sensation in his chest.
The solid cavern wall extended sharp earthen spikes, piercing his body, clearly bearing the traces of Essence Skills!
Naray, who was providing cover, was taking action!
"..."
"An Elemental Manipulator?" The Deviator's eyes lit up.
Ignoring the gaping hole in his chest, he looked at the dark maze passage with excitement:
"I heard these old friends had been eliminated by the new generation of Awakened, never thought I'd see them again here!"
"Come out, young man!"
"In this place, you probably won't get the subsequent inheritance of an Elemental Manipulator..."
Mid-sentence, the Deviator stopped himself.
It wasn't that he had given up on persuading them to surrender, but he realized his voice couldn't be heard over Levi's storm.
So, he refocused his gaze on Levi, who was charging towards him.
A line of fire was drawn in the storm created by the sound.
With his rich combat experience, the Deviator quickly determined Levi's attack path, and the flesh on his chest began to twist.
Whoosh!
Violet-black tentacles shot out.
Just as Levi was about to reach the Deviator in the storm, the tentacles suddenly lashed out, sending him flying backwards.
The next second, as Levi's injury caused the storm to weaken, the Deviator prepared to advance.
"Hmph, such a young man," the Deviator said with a relaxed demeanor.
In that instant, the ground beneath the Deviator's feet sank, trapping his legs, while the surrounding air became agitated, forming sharp currents that sliced at the Deviator's body.
Whoosh, whoosh, whoosh!
The swift winds danced.
This Deviator's defense wasn't particularly strong, but his regenerative abilities were astonishing.
In the blink of an eye, he became a bloodied monster in the currents, and these fresh wounds began to heal at a visible rate.
"Indeed, an Elemental Manipulator!" The Deviator was pleased.
He looked towards the direction where Naray was hiding, the source of these skills was in that pitch-black corner!
"Damn monster!" Levi, who had just been knocked to the ground and coughing up blood, stood up again.
He glared at this seemingly indestructible enemy, gripped his longsword tightly, and rose to his feet. He began to compress his Essence Skills to their most subtle state, just as Lin Sai had suggested, focusing on the finer details.
Since direct and powerful attacks weren't effective, he would approach it from a different angle.
The concept of triggering the smallest vibration from sound, amplifying the damage range, and thereby destroying the opponent's internal structure.
"..."
"Stop playing around!"
The Deviator's movements were even faster.
Just as Levi was about to unleash his skill, the violet-black tentacles lunged towards his chest.
At this moment, the Elemental Manipulator, Naray, had just finished casting his skill and couldn't provide support in time.
Levi was about to be impaled through the chest by the Deviator's tentacles!
"Get away!"
Boom!
Arrows and attacks imbued with Essence skills suddenly appeared.
They poured into the battlefield like a rainstorm, repelling the violet-black tentacles that were about to pierce Levi's chest.
The Deviator turned his head and saw more humans emerging from the darkness.
They were other Legion Commanders.
Noticing the intense battle, these warriors abandoned their rest without hesitation.
They all sprang into action, joining the fight to help Levi secure victory!
"..."
"Well, now that you're all here."
"Saves me the trouble of searching for you little ones."
The Deviator's smile remained as he saw the enemies appearing one after another.
He quickly retracted the tentacles he had just extended.
Then, on this rapidly repairing body, a stench-filled essence instantly emerged, enveloping the entire cave in the blink of an eye, filling the air with a nauseating odor.
The Deviator's apparent strength was indeed that of a Phase Five.
But his true nature was not so.
At this moment, he drastically unleashed his power, using four-fifths of his essence as a cost, forcibly unleashing a Phase Six skill far beyond his current stage."
"Ah?"
"My hand won't obey me?"
"Throw your weapons away first!"
The Legion Commanders immediately retreated, trying to move out of the Deviator's attack range.
Whether it was Levi, Naray, or the others, all the Awakened within the cave were affected by the Deviator's skill without exception.
The twisted life will descended upon them.
This power infected the human bodies, rapidly corrupting their flesh with the Corrupting Venom.
Within just a few breaths, everyone felt parts of their bodies rebelling, no longer under the control of their brains!
"Oh?"
"You can resist the twisted will's infection?"
This time, it was the Deviator who was surprised.
His skill of twisting life will should have twisted these lower-stage Awakened into lower-stage Deviators.
But now, the effect was greatly diminished.
It only severely impaired their ability to act.
The reason for the Deviator's incomprehension was simple.
Lindsey had left behind seeds of the Wilted Tyrant Blossom, and consuming them increased resistance to the Corrupting Venom.
All the Legion Commanders had used these items, which was why they hadn't completely turned into monsters.
"Yet another unheard-of thing."
"Besides countering the plague's toxins, there's also a way to enhance flesh resistance?"
The Deviator furrowed his brows.
But then, he thought of something and a smile appeared on his face.
"Well, that's good too."
"You guys with such strong resistance and these interesting bug corpses."
"If I can incorporate them into our skill system, I might just break through my previous limits!"
The Deviator was smug.
Just as he was about to move forward to finish off the others...
In the southernmost passage of the maze, a lightning-fast figure appeared, and a silent arrow flew towards him from the darkness.
